AIR FRANCE KLM WINS BUSINESS AIRLINE OF THE YEAR 2012 AT THE BUSINESS TRAVEL AWARDS

The AIR FRANCE KLM Group has won the accolade of Business Airline of the Year at the 2012 Business Travel Awards. The Group beat off stiff competition from British Airways, Flybe, Lufthansa and Qatar, to win the category.

AIR FRANCE KLM was awarded the title of Business Airline of the Year at a gala dinner held at the Grosvenor House Hotel on 23 January 2012. The award was won based on a number of key criteria which clearly demonstrated the Group’s commitment to the business community and the support it offers corporate travel buyers. The award looked at corporate client retention, product innovation, CSR policies, specific corporate products, training, route network and more.

The Judges felt that AIR FRANCE KLM, the winner of this important category, had been listening to what customers want, and was delivering. The Judges were impressed with AIR FRANCE KLM’s excellent feeder network, including a number of new links, and with its truly worldwide coverage.

Says Henri Hourcade, General Manager, AIR FRANCE KLM UK & Ireland, 'This is a real feather in our cap, particularly for our sales and commercial teams who have worked tirelessly over the last 12 months to ensure that we’ve offered the best possible pricing structures, bespoke contracts, innovative products and customer support to our key corporate and business customers. We’re thrilled to have won this award which has set a high benchmark for us to work towards for the coming year and which I know will encourage us to strive for more BTA accolades next year.’

The AIR FRANCE KLM Group was also shortlisted for Best Long-Haul Airline and Best Short-Haul Airline in the 2012 Awards line up.
